Desiccant Dehumidification Cost In Lillian, AL

The cost of Desiccant Dehumidification in Lillian, AL, can vary depending on the severity of the moisture iss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on a thorough assessment of your property and may include more costs for equipment, labor, and materials.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Planning $200 - $500 Severity of moisture issue, size of affected area
Equipment Setup and Execution $500 - $2,500 Equipment costs, labor, and materials
Monitoring and Adjustment $100 - $500 Frequency of monitoring, adjustments required
Final Inspection and Clearance $100 - $300 Frequency of inspection, complexity of job
More Drying Agents $500 - $2,000 Type and quantity of agents required
Insurance Claims Help $0 - $500 Complexity of claims process, frequency of communication
